Abstract
The utility model discloses a kind of annual output 60000 tons of hard (carbon) black wet granulation devices, tablets press housing forward end top is provided with powdery carbon black inlet pipe and granulation water spray gun jack, granulation water spray gun jack is provided with granulation water temp control device, tablets press housing tail end top is provided with steam inlet pipe, steam inlet pipe is provided with steam flow and the chain self-con-tained unit of temperature, steam outlet pipe and granulation case temperature meter is provided with bottom tablets press housing forward end, granulation carbon black outlet pipe is provided with bottom tablets press housing tail end, tablets press housing cavity is built-in is provided with the central rotating shaft that tooth is stirred in granulation, central rotating shaft two ends are connected with the two ends of tablets press housing respectively.Technique effect of the present utility model is: pelletizing of carbon black uniform particles, and improve granulation ability and granulation outcome, production efficiency increases substantially, and energy-saving and cost-reducing, economic benefit, social benefit is remarkable.

Background technology
Ecosystem carbon black is a kind of powdery substance, light specific gravity, being unfavorable for transport and subsequent production processing, in order to reduce the protection of transportation cost and environment, powdery carbon black must being processed into particulate matter.And carbon black wet granulator is just used to dust carbon black to be processed into fine particle shape carbon black.In granulation process, need dust carbon black in tablets press to spray into granulation water; (powdery carbon black is through degassed to stir the stirring of tooth and prograding by tablets press; moistened surface; carbon black nucleation granulating, compacting and polishing five processes) make dustless carbon black and binding agent Homogeneous phase mixing progressively form fine granularity carbon black.Original agglomeration technique will lean on filling kerosene; hard (carbon) black granulation is just made substantially to reach requirement; but granulation carbon black particle size distribution; outer viewing is not very even; it is comparatively large with the carbon black pellet proportion being less than less than 0.25 that particle diameter is greater than more than 2mm, and the wind affecting user's carbon black send the unimpeded of line of pipes.

Compared to former tablets press; technique effect of the present utility model is: 1, former background technology granulation ability is annual output 40000 tons of hard (carbon) blacks; the utility model technology granulation ability is annual output 60000 tons of hard (carbon) blacks; granulation ability improves 50%; production efficiency increases substantially; energy-saving and cost-reducing, economic benefit, social benefit is remarkable.
2, former background technology granulator powder-material inlet pipe is circular, and sectional area is little; The utility model technology changes inlet pipe into rectangle, and close with tablets press inner barrel size as far as possible, and powder carbon black blanking sectional area is large; make powder carbon black energy evenly be distributed in tablets press inner chamber; can be more abundant with granulation water, more uniformly contact, thus improve granulation ability.
3, the utility model technology is stirred tooth crest and is reduced 2mm from granulation inner barrel distance than background technology tablets press; stir tooth and stir space width and suitably reduce, stir tooth helix pitch and reduce, one is strengthen stirring action; extend pelletizing of carbon black stroke, thus improve granulation ability.
4, former background technology granulation water temp general≤40 DEG C, the utility model technology granulation water temp sets up temperature-control device, and enable granulation water temp according to different situation, constant temperature at 60-95 DEG C, thus improves granulation outcome.
5, former background technology is often because tablets press case temperature is on the low side, causes inner barrel inwall to tie one deck carbon black, affects pelletizing of carbon black effect; The utility model technology, spiral baffle is provided with at granulation inner barrel, and steam flow and the chain automatic control of granulation case temperature, strengthen whole granulation case temperature uniformly transfer heat effect, ensure that granulation inner housing temperature is being greater than operation at X DEG C, the coking black phenomenon of inner barrel inwall can be avoided completely, thus improve granulation ability.
6, former background technology needs to add kerosene to improve granulation outcome, the carbon black pellet ratio about 68% of 0.5mm+1mm in carbon black; Under the utility model technology does not need to add coal oil condition, the carbon black pellet ratio of 0.5mm+1mm brings up to 87%, and the apparent homogeneity of particle diameter improves greatly, and powdery content significantly reduces.

Utility model works principle: powdery carbon black enters tablets press inner chamber 14 continuously from powdery carbon black inlet pipe 1, central rotating shaft 10 is continuous rotation under the drive of motor, central rotating shaft 10 is welded with granulation with spiral trajectory vertically and stirs tooth 7, each tooth that stirs has certain interval, stir tooth from inner barrel 6≤Xmm, powdery carbon black is under the effect of tooth is stirred in granulation, be evenly distributed in granulation inner chamber 14, granulation water sprays into granulation water from granulation water spray gun jack 2, granulation water mixes with powdery carbon black uniform contact, powdery carbon black stirs tooth 7 at granulation water and granulation, constantly be uniformly mixed and push ahead, powdery carbon black is through degassed, moistened surface, carbon black nucleation granulating, compacting be polished to particulate state carbon black, bottom tablets press body skin 4 tail end, granulation carbon black outlet pipe 11 enters wet method carbon black dryer and is dried to finished product carbon black, granulation hydraulic giant is connected with granulation water temp control device 3, to guarantee that granulation water temp is greater than X DEG C, is less than X DEG C, to improve granulation outcome, steam jacket 5 in the sandwich structure of tablets press body skin 4 passes into steam, and is connected to case temperature self-con-tained unit 8, to ensure that tablets press inner barrel 6 has enough temperature, avoids wet carbon black glue inwall and reduce granulation outcome.
